Wesnoth 1.6.4 is out!
This is a bugfix release for the 1.6.x series and it is compatible with the other 1.6.x versions.

The main reason for this release was a fix required for some strange regression in the network code that prevented many users from up- or downloading bigger add-ons as well as hosting games making use of those add-ons. This release should fix all those issues. Beside this some smaller bugs were fixed, not too much exciting stuff though...

Of course there is also the full changelog listing (almost) all the changes since 1.6.3. A changelog with changes that might be visible to most users (and only includes these) is the players changelog.

The multiplayer server for 1.6.4 is already up and running. This server can be used to play with 1.5.13, 1.5.14, 1.6, 1.6.1, 1.6.2, 1.6.3, 1.6.4 as well as all 1.6.x releases that are to follow. If you do encounter problems, please report them.

By now the add-on server already offers much content that should be completely compatible with 1.5.13, 1.5.14, 1.6, 1.6.1, 1.6.2, 1.6.3, 1.6.4 as well as all upcoming 1.6.x releases.
